Michael Kistler is a Principal Program Manager on Microsoft's .NET Platform team with decades of engineering and developer-experience leadership spanning IBM and Azure SDK work. He focuses on tooling that makes developers more productive—building SDK generators, API docs, CLIs, Terraform and Crossplane providers—and has contributed backend work to microsoft/typespec including an OpenAPI 3 emitter with thorough unit tests. Based in Austin, he brings a rare blend of deep technical craftsmanship and product leadership, informed by advanced CS study and an MBA. As an OpenAPI Initiative Technical Steering Committee member, he helps shape API standards while continuing to ship pragmatic developer tooling at scale.
